About This Book
The air suddenly feels different—no more heavy footsteps or things falling down. In the quiet town of Cayuga Ridge, something strange is happening when the gravity switch goes off. What will happen when nothing sticks to the ground anymore?
Quick Assessment
This early reader fiction introduces young children to the concept of gravity through an imaginative story set in the small town of Cayuga Ridge. When the gravity company’s switch is accidentally turned off, the town experiences unusual events that engage kids’ curiosity and encourage scientific thinking. Appropriate for ages 5-8, the book uses simple language and vivid imagery to support early reading skills.
